Wound Care & Dressings in Canada
FinalMedic stocks advanced wound-care dressings and skin-care products from Coloplast, Hollister, ConvaTec and Medline. Choosing the right dressing depends on the wound type and how much it drains (exudate) — when in doubt, follow your clinician’s or wound-care nurse’s plan.
Dressing types at a glance
Foam — absorbent and cushioning, for moderate to heavy exudate.
Hydrocolloid — keeps a moist environment for light exudate; good for shallow wounds and pressure areas.
Alginate — highly absorbent seaweed-based fibre for heavy exudate and packing deeper wounds.
Hydrogel — adds moisture to dry or sloughy wounds to support debridement.
Transparent film — a thin, breathable cover for shallow, low-exudate wounds and securing other dressings.
Antimicrobial (silver) — helps manage wounds at risk of infection.
